Corona Mexico 200 - Colin Braun Notes

Colin Braun
Autodromo Hermanos Rodriguez
Mexico City, Mexico
NASCAR Nationwide Series: Corona Mexico 200

FAST FACTS

  • This is Braun’s first Nationwide Series race at Autodromo Hermanos Rodriguez.
  • He has two Rolex Grand AM Daytona Prototype starts on the track; finishing second in both 2006 and 2007.
  • Braun has one previous Nationwide Series start this season.
  • He qualified ninth and finished 15th at Nashville Superspeedway in March.
  • The 19-year-old Craftsman Truck Series regular prepared for this weekend with his Roush Fenway Racing teammates by testing at Virginia International Raceway last month.
  • Braun has five years of road racing experience including three years in the Rolex Grand AM series.

    Colin Braun – NNS ADVANCE
    Team: No. 16 3M Ford Fusion
    Crew Chief: Eddie Pardue
    Chassis: RK-488 (Braun tested at VIR last month)

    Colin Braun on racing at Mexico City:
    “I’m really excited to get to Mexico City this weekend. It’ll be fun to be at a track where I have more experience than a lot of the other Nationwide Series drivers. I know the 3M Ford Fusion will be fast. We tested this car at VIR a few weeks ago and it felt great. I’m ready to get down there – it’s going to be a lot of fun.”

    Crew Chief Eddie Pardue on racing at Mexico City:
    “We are thrilled that Colin is driving for us this weekend. He’s proven he can win road course races. This is a track he feels really comfortable on and we’re excited to get going. We’re taking a good car and I expect Colin to run up front all weekend.”
